I think I am fairly along in this game, but stuck at a mini-game that I don't understand. It is where you drag some perfume droplets through a maze from a source to two bottles. There are nodes in the maze that interact with them as you drag them along the way. (I'm not sure why, or what this interaction is ~ part of the problem.) You can choose to interact with a lot of the nodes or skip nearly all of them.

It looks like you start with seven units of this perfume essence. Of the two bottles on the right of the puzzle, one is marked "1 x times" and the other "2 x times" or something like that. It is not clear whether this means you need to DEPOSIT one drop to the first bottle and two drops to the second; another option is that it could mean find a route where you only LOSE one drop getting to the first and two to the second ~ this is the other part of the problem.

In any case, I can drag the droplets through the maze without exhausting the quantity available, either way; in fact, it actually will go UP. But this doesn't solve whatever the mini-game is asking me to do. Does anyone know what the point/goal of this puzzle is? I know you can't understand this query without having played the game. Hopefully, someone else has and can help.

Is this the puzzle
http://www.casualgameguides.com/games/ck...Gazebo-Game.jpg

If it is, it looks like you're supposed to draw paths to go through the golden blobs. You start with 8 units of fluid, and each time you pass through a golden blob (dispersal unit) you decrement by one unit. By the time you get to the top perfume bottle, you should have gone through 7 golden blobs so you have 1 unit of fluid left. You start over for the bottom bottle. By the time you get to the bottom perfume bottle, you should have gone through 6 golden blobs so you have 2 units of fluid left for the bottle.

And BTW, this is a helluva game. I bought the CE in last week's half-price sale. It is pretty conventional, in the familiar style of the rest of the series, and the structure as well as the HO scenes are not innovative, but the graphics are beautifully rendered, there are lots of different scenes, very few cheap shots, and the mini-games are excellent. There were a couple of sliders, but they weren't horrible. Two of the mini-games had instructions that were pretty vague (useless, actually) and the Game Guide only gives you the Solution, so be prepared to twiddle a lot on a couple of them before you can figure out what you are supposed to do, much less solve it. Even looking up a WT on line doesn't help, as they simply repeat what is in the Game Guide already. ha ha Part of the fun, I guess.

I've just finished the main game and started on the Bonus Game. The game is satisfyingly long! There is a LOT of shagging your butt around, to go back to places where you finally can use that item you just found, so you do have to take notes (if you've turned off all the cheats that tell you what to do next), but if you enjoy figuring it out on your own, this is a fun one! There is a Map function that will let you quickly jam to the place you want. I definitely will be replaying this one after some time has passed and I've forgotten the details.
